changing static IP of a RODC
We have RODC setup with an static IP in one of our sites. Now we need to move this RODC to a new site where the static IPs are different. Please advise if it is ok to change the static ip of the RODC, will this complicate the production enviroment? Do we
need to take anything else into consideration?

You can move the domain controller to another site with no problem as long as routing is correctly configured between subnets so it can replicate with other DC's. Make sure that name resolution is also functional and remember to make possible necessary adjustments,
like configuring in the dhcp scope the proper DNS servers (if rodc is DNS)...
Also there is an article from microsoft regarding changeing the ip address of a DC:
http://technet.microsoft.com/en-us/library/cc794931(v=ws.10).aspx
In short, there should be no issue.
